The photographer Francesca Woodman (1958-1981), who died prematurely, produced several artist's books during her years, but only one was published during her lifetime. The complete edition of all eight surviving artist's books from Mack is graphically and typographically simple yet stunning. Most of the author's publications are based on 19th-century Italian handbooks and diaries she purchased during her time in Rome, which are additionally interspersed with photographs, slides, and notes. All of this is seen here in perfect reproductions of complete double-page spreads, accurately inserted into the spine of the four-hundred-page book, including bookmarks, ribbons and fraying. The pinnacle of painstaking perfection is the nine blank double-page lined scrapbooks, yet they go far beyond the small scholarly comments between books.
